ZrO2 Pipe & ZrO2 Tube & ZrO2 Rod
ZrO2 Pipe, ZrO2 Tube, and ZrO2 Rod are all examples of Advanced Ceramics that are commonly used in various industrial applications. These components are made from zirconia (ZrO2), a highly durable and heat-resistant material that is ideal for use in high-temperature environments.
ZrO2 Pipes, Tubes, and Rods are often used as Ceramic Insulator in electrical equipment and machinery, due to their excellent electrical insulation properties. They are also commonly used in the production of Engineering Ceramics, where their high strength and resistance to corrosion make them ideal for use in demanding applications.
Overall, ZrO2 Pipes, Tubes, and Rods are essential components in the field of advanced ceramics, offering superior performance and reliability in a wide range of industrial settings.
Technical Parameters:
Item | Unit | Al2O3 95%-97% | Al2O3 99% |
Desity | g/cm3 | 3.7 | 3.85 |
Flexural Strength | Mpa | 300 | 340 |
Compressive Strength | Mpa | 3400 | 3600 |
Modulus of Elaslicity | Gpa | 350 | 380 |
Impact Resistance | Mpa m1/2 | 4.0 | 5 |
Weibull Moudulus | m | 10.0 | 10 |
Vickers Hardness | HV0.5 | 1200.0 | 1300 |
Thermal Expansion Coefficent | 10-6K-1 | 5.0-8.3 | 5.4-8.3 |
Thermal Conductivity | W/mK | 24 | 27 |
Thermal Shork Resistance | △T℃ | 250 | 270 |
Maximum Use Temperature | ℃ | 1600 | 1650 |
Volume Resistivity at 20℃ | Ω | ≥1014 | ≥1014 |
Dielectric Constant | KV/mm | 20 | 25 |
Open Porosity | % | 0 | 0 |
Dielectric Constant | ξr | 10 | 10 |
Dielectric Loss Angle | Tanσ | 0.001 | 0.001 |
Item | Unit | ZrO2 | ZTA |
Desity | g/cm3 | 6.05 | 4.1 |
Flexural Strength | Mpa | 1300 | 480 |
Compressive Strength | Mpa | 3000 | 3300 |
Modulus of Elaslicity | Gpa | 205 | 320 |
Impact Resistance | Mpa m1/2 | 12 | 7 |
Weibull Moudulus | m | 25 | 15 |
Vickers Hardness | HV0.5 | 1150 | 1600 |
Thermal Expansion Coefficent | 10-6K-1 | 10 | 9 |
Thermal Conductivity | W/mK | 2 | 20 |
Thermal Shork Resistance | △T℃ | 280 | 260 |
Max Useage Temperature | ℃ | 1000 | 1600 |
Volume Resistivity at 20℃ | Ω | ≥1010 | ≥1012 |
Open Porosity | % | 0 | 0 |
